|
|
Linux-3.3内核make menuconfig中7 h8 k' ^, [4 g4 y
System Type ---->Ti Davinci Implementations ----> TI DA850/OMAP-L138/AM18X Reference Platform
7 |$ G9 U" r* J1 L& K3 v/ B. w; l1 oSystem Type ---->Ti Davinci Implementations ----> DA850 SDI Development Board+ }) a7 m+ H: y0 z: `) j% F
这两个都要选择吗?而Linux-2.6.33内核只有第一个。。。
8 t& f/ W( o1 |. |) Z; {* V! x, @$ `; c. N& k4 A4 `, b3 k
3 L" \+ i0 F5 F) p$ O
我用的是SPI Nor Flash 为w25q128芯片,采用MTD分区存放不同的固件程序,其中/dev/mtd2为内核分区,/dev/mtd3为ubifs文件系统分区。
7 N" w2 V/ t- ?# XLinux-3.3内核arch/arm/mach-davinci目录下有board-da850-evm.c和board-da850-sdi.c两个文件。
, z0 q! Q; i5 D% x6 L( d( Y/ O3 d' B1 k9 z
修改MTD分区及SPI驱动是修改board-da850-evm.c文件,还需要修改board-da850-sdi.c文件吗?: I) x; ^. a$ w& R' ~& }6 ^: y
|
|